<p>SEATTLE&#8211;(<span itemprop="provider publisher copyrightHolder" itemscope="itemscope" itemtype="https://schema.org/Organization" itemid="https://www.businesswire.com"><span itemprop="name">BUSINESS WIRE</span></span>)&#8211;Cabana, the modern, mobile hospitality company with a fleet of high quality, high-tech campervans, today announced its upcoming launch into the San Francisco market, with a formal launch set to take place later this summer.  With existing operations in Los Angeles and Seattle, Cabana&#8217;s San Francisco presence marks a major growth milestone for the company, and the first of several additional US expansions set to roll out over the next year.
</p>
<p>As the desire to travel spikes––with the World Travel &#038; Tourism Council projecting domestic tourism to reach pre-pandemic levels this year, contributing upwards of $1 trillion to the US economy––Cabana is enabling seamless and unique travel experiences by merging accommodation and Transportation with personalized, contactless trip planning.  Cabana&#8217;s services are actively empowering guests to explore the road less traveled and make the most of their time on vacation.
</p>
<p>“The pandemic has permanently shifted how people want to travel, prioritizing memorable experiences over simply taking a trip,” said Scott Kubly, Cabana CEO and founder.  “Cabana&#8217;s offering––from our contactless rental process and easy-to-use van, to Cabana Guides booking your campsite for you––allows guests to focus on enjoying the journey, not worrying about the logistics.  Cabana is excited to offer Bay Area residents and those visiting the city a new way to explore.”
</p>
<p>Cabana&#8217;s introduction into San Francisco demonstrates the company&#8217;s continued momentum since launching in 2020, further solidifying the brand&#8217;s innovation and leadership in the travel industry.  Cabana believes that modern mobile hospitality is the future of travel, where technology and design grant ultimate flexibility and freedom for consumers.  The company continues to introduce consumers to RV or campervan vacations, with nearly 70% of customers since launch having never operated an RV prior to their Cabana experience.  This announcement also comes on the heels of a successful partnership with iconic outdoor brand, Eddie Bauer, from which gear will be available to rent in the San Francisco market.
</p>
<p>&#8220;We absolutely loved our experience with Cabana, being able to be in nature but also have a totally comfy bed and warm van to stay in with our dogs,&#8221; said Cabana customer Jamie R. from Los Angeles. &#8220;I&#8217;m so sad our trip is over and hope to plan another soon.&#8221;
</p>
<p>Cabana&#8217;s San Francisco fleet will start with 20 campervans––with projected growth to over 50 by the end of the year––and will be available to take off starting late this summer.  In tandem with the launch, Cabana will offer Bay Area trips complete with campsite reservations and experiences, helping to take the guesswork out of trip planning.  Expected top trip requests include wine tastings, the iconic Highway 1, Yosemite National Park, and Mammoth for lake swims, hot springs, and winter sports. <p>SAM won two Global Infosec Awards for 2022, sponsored by Cyber ​​Defense Magazine (CDM), in the categories of &#8220;Unique SMB Cybersecurity&#8221; products and the &#8220;Editor&#8217;s Choice – Internet of Things (IoT) Security.&#8221;  In addition, SAM has been named as the winner in the Network Security category of the 2022 Fortress Cyber ​​Security Awards, sponsored by the Business Intelligence Group. </p>
<p>This year marks the 10th anniversary of the CDM Global Infosec Awards, which honor industry innovators with products and services with unique and compelling value propositions.  The Fortress Cyber ​​Security Awards identify and reward the world&#8217;s leading products keeping data and digital assets safe among growing threats within the digital landscape for households and SMBs.</p>
<p>SAM previously won a Global Infosec Award in 2020, in the &#8220;Most Innovative Internet of Things</p>
<p>Cyber ​​Security Solutions&#8221; category. </p>
<p>In response to trends within the industry, SAM has been studying the behavior of devices for years, building a huge database of 460 million devices and communication patterns.  In this manner the company continuously assesses the risk a new IoT device might introduce to a specific network in real-time.  The company&#8217;s understanding of tomorrow&#8217;s threats, delivery of seamless IoT security and deep visibility solutions with no impact on performance are at the core of SAM&#8217;s promise to its customers.  In its growing coverage of securing unmanaged devices and networks, SAM continues to fight against compromises related to the security of individuals and businesses alike, while improving customer experience and enabling business growth for telecom providers.</p>

<p>A Muni Metro driver may soon be able to enter a station, refer to a centralized map of regional transit connections, and pay a single fixed tariff for travel between providers and counties.</p>
<p>Congregation member David Chiu enacted the Seamless and Resilient Transit Act in the Bay Area on Wednesday.  This is the final step in decades of efforts to create a more integrated transport network for the area and encourage residents to get out of their cars.</p>
<p>&#8220;Every day, hundreds of thousands of Bay Area residents have experienced a system that is fragmented, unreliable, difficult to use and inefficient,&#8221; Chiu said.  &#8220;That&#8217;s the big picture.&#8221;</p>
<p>Despite its well-known reputation as a hub of innovation, the Bay Area has historically been home to one of the most inefficient, underutilized and costly transportation networks in the country.</p>
<p>As of 2017, only 5 percent of journeys in the Bay Area were in transit, and the number of per capita transit drivers decreased by 12 percent between 1991 and 2016, according to legislation.</p>
<p>While 31 percent of regional ground workers rely on public transportation, they are often faced with unreliable and misaligned connections between transit providers, high tariffs, long commutes, and in general a system so confusing that the idea of ​​navigating it is daunting enough can instead push someone into a personal vehicle.</p>
<p>The same communities are most likely to bear the brunt of the environmental and health impacts caused by congestion and greenhouse gas emissions.</p>
<p>&#8220;We need to rebuild a transit system that works for everyone, especially our low-income residents and our residents of color communities around the bay,&#8221; said Chiu.  &#8220;We need to do this in a way that is efficient, reliable, and has real access so that all of our families and workers can get to their jobs, schools and critical destinations quickly and efficiently.&#8221;</p>
<p>Gathering Bill 629 aims to simplify the landscape by focusing on four main areas for improvement: regional mapping and pathfinding;  a pilot program for tariff integration;  the creation of a network of priority transit routes to identify which corridors need to be addressed most urgently;  and mandatory use of real-time open transit data by providers to inform travelers&#8217; decisions.</p>
<p>The Metropolitan Transportation Commission would be empowered to determine how the bill&#8217;s requirements were carried out, though it would coordinate itself with the transit agencies and be given clear metrics and deadlines to ensure that the nine counties regional facility is on track stay, said Chiu.</p>
<p>If passed, MTC would have to create a pilot program for tariff integration by July 1, 2023 with which a single pass with a uniform tariff structure would be created for travelers in three countries.</p>
<p>It would also mandate the Commission to develop a standardized regional transit mapping and routing system by July 1, 2024, and a plan for its maintenance and funding until the following year.</p>
<p>Chiu introduced a similar bill in February 2020, just weeks before the COVID-19 pandemic hit and turned the state&#8217;s legislative agenda on its head.  The bill was pushed into the background, but a few months later the regional transit leaders formed a working group under the Metropolitan Transportation Commission to begin a dialogue on how to address the region&#8217;s lack of integration, the Blue Ribbon Task Force.</p>
<p>Much of this legislation is reflected in AB 629, with the exception of the previous requirement to set up a working group of transit managers for coordination work, a process already being carried out with the Blue Ribbon Task Force.</p>
<p>Now that the region is beginning to rise to the challenge of recreation, the goal of a seamless transit network is more important than ever.</p>
<p>&#8220;As we recover, we are all very concerned that our transit systems have been decimated and we need to make sure that as we rebuild and restore we are building a 21st century transit system for the ages,&#8221; Chiu said.</p>
<p>The call for a more integrated transportation system in the Bay Area has been around for decades, but it has erupted again and again, even as other cities like Seattle and London have managed to tackle fragmentation.</p>
<p>Opposition often came from transit agency officials, who said the integration of tariffs &#8211; and therefore Farebox revenue &#8211; could jeopardize their ability to provide reasonable service and maintenance, even though they are anxious to find ways to make timetables better Synchronize and improve pathfinding Keeping up-to-date or acting quickly to respond to local needs.</p>
<p>&#8220;We are not saying that there has to be a tariff system today and we have to find out immediately,&#8221; said Chiu.  &#8220;But we say there needs to be a conversation about how people can travel through more than one transit operator while ideally paying a flat rate.&#8221;</p>
<p>Details would largely be worked out through the collaboration between these transit agency heads and the MTC.</p>
<p>&#8220;Our region cannot wait any longer,&#8221; said Chiu.</p>
